Let’s break the taboo around prostate issues

Too often, men associate the health of their prostate gland with their virility and this makes them embarrassed to admit something might be wrong. Too often, early symptoms are ignored or simply endured, and exactly this is problematic. Early diagnosis of prostate issues can make treatment easier and successful without much impact on the quality of life.

What is D-mannose and how can it help you get rid of UTI’s?

D-mannose is a kind of sugar molecule closely related to glucose. It occurs naturally in the body and we can get it from fruit & berries such as apples, oranges, peaches, blueberries, and, cranberries. But also vegetables, including green beans, cabbage, and broccoli are a common source.
